All Canadians must make a firm and lasting commitment to reconciliation, says a report released this morning on the country’s residential school system. The summary report refers to the system as a form of “cultural genocide” and makes 94 recommendations ” to ensure that Canada is a country where [Indigenous] children and grandchildren can thrive.” The head of the TRC, Justice Murray Sinclair, pictured here in Ottawa, said June 2 that “reconciliation is not an Aboriginal problem. It is a Canadian problem. It involves all of us.” Stay tuned to more coverage of the report and today’s events at Nunatsiaqonline.ca. (PHOTO BY JIM BELL)
